Recently, Mexican film star Diego Boneta, who joined the live-action "Monster Hunter" movie, posted a still of himself in the "Monster Hunter" movie on Instagram. Some people said that it was not recognizable as a "Monster Hunter" movie, and some said: "What's with that modern-looking fully automatic gun?" The scene in the photo looks like a hot and dry wasteland. I wonder if it is related to the famous "Big Ant Mound Wasteland" in the game. On October 13, the heroine Milla Jovovich posted a photo of herself and Tony Jaa on Instagram, as well as some photos of the shooting scene, with the scene being a vast desert. The live-action "Monster Hunter" movie will revolve around a United Nations army named "Artemis". Milla Jovovich plays the captain of the army, who is teleported to another world inhabited by monsters, where she meets a hunter (played by Tony Jaa). They have to work together to close a portal to prevent monsters from attacking the earth. |
